🥘 Ingredient Notes for the Best Pasta Salad

The secret to this perfectly creamy and tangy dressing lies in combining elements from two different dressing recipes, resulting in an unparalleled flavor profile. You’ll need these simple, fresh ingredients to bring this easy pasta salad recipe to life:

ingredients for chicken bacon pasta ranch salad in glass bowls, labelled
  • Bacon: Crispy bacon bits are essential for that signature smoky, salty crunch. For ultimate convenience and minimal mess, consider purchasing pre-cooked bacon (like the kind found at Costco). These slices can be quickly heated in the microwave for a couple of minutes, saving you from greasy cleanup. Alternatively, baking bacon in the oven yields perfectly crisp results with less splattering than stovetop frying.
  • Boneless, Skinless Chicken Breasts: We use chicken breasts for their lean protein and versatility. You can either dice them into bite-sized pieces for a hearty texture or shred them for a softer, more integrated component. A fantastic kitchen hack for shredding chicken quickly and easily is to use your stand mixer (jump to Expert Tips for details on this time-saving trick!). Leftover rotisserie chicken is also an excellent option for even quicker prep.
  • Vermicelli Noodles: While many pasta shapes work well, vermicelli noodles are particularly ideal for this pasta salad. Their thin, delicate strands cook faster than thicker spaghetti and are perfectly sized to absorb the rich, creamy dressing without becoming mushy or breaking apart under the weight of the other ingredients. This ensures every bite is flavorful and well-textured.
  • Dry Ranch Dressing Mix: This is the backbone of our creamy dressing. We highly recommend using Hidden Valley dry ranch seasoning mix for its authentic, consistent, and widely loved flavor profile, which provides the classic tangy kick that defines a ranch-style salad.
  • Italian Dressing: To achieve that perfect balance of creamy and tangy, a good quality Italian dressing is incorporated. You can use your favorite brand, whether it’s a zesty vinaigrette or a creamier variety. This adds an extra layer of herbaceous flavor and a bright acidity that cuts through the richness of the bacon and mayonnaise.
  • Fresh Vegetables: A colorful assortment of fresh vegetables not only adds vibrant crunch and essential nutrients but also enhances the overall flavor. We recommend:
    • Tomatoes: Large, ripe tomatoes, or sweet cherry/grape tomatoes, for juicy bursts of freshness.
    • Cucumber: A refreshing English cucumber provides a cool, crisp texture.
    • Bell Peppers: Both green and yellow bell peppers (or red for extra sweetness) offer a lovely crunch and mild, sweet flavor.
    • Red Onion: Finely diced red onion adds a subtle pungent bite and beautiful color, which mellows slightly in the dressing.

🔪 How to Make Bacon Ranch Chicken Pasta Salad: Step-by-Step

Creating this flavorful pasta salad is straightforward and comes together in just a few simple steps. Here’s how to prepare your creamy bacon ranch chicken pasta salad:

Prep Work: Begin by preparing your protein and pasta. Cook the chicken (dice or shred as preferred) and bacon, then set them aside to cool. (For perfect crispy bacon, refer to our Top Tip below!). Next, cook your chosen pasta according to package directions until it’s al dente. Drain the pasta thoroughly and rinse it with cold water to stop the cooking process and prevent sticking. This also helps cool it down for the cold salad.

STEP 1: Prepare the Dressing

In a small bowl, whisk together all the salad dressing ingredients until thoroughly combined and smooth. This includes the dry ranch dressing mix, milk, mayonnaise, red wine vinegar, white vinegar, olive oil, water, and Italian dressing. Ensure there are no lumps from the dry mix. Set aside.

STEP 2: Combine Salad Components

In a large mixing bowl, combine all your prepared salad ingredients: the cooled, cooked pasta, the diced or shredded chicken, crumbled bacon, and all the fresh, chopped vegetables (tomatoes, cucumber, green bell pepper, yellow bell pepper, and red onion). Give them a gentle toss to distribute evenly. Then, pour the homemade creamy ranch dressing over the mixture. *If you prefer, you can cut some chicken into larger chunks to showcase on top, while mixing smaller bite-sized pieces throughout the salad.

STEP 3: Mix and Garnish

Thoroughly mix all ingredients until the pasta and every vegetable piece are beautifully coated in the creamy dressing. For the best flavor, allow the salad to ch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before serving. Garnish generously with grated Parmesan cheese, fresh parsley, or a sprinkle of extra bacon bits, if desired, just before serving.

Expert Tips for a Perfect Pasta Salad

  • Cook Pasta Al Dente: This is crucial! Overcooked, mushy pasta will ruin the texture of your salad. Cook the pasta only until it’s al dente (still firm to the bite) according to package directions. Immediately after draining, rinse it thoroughly with cold water to halt the cooking process and prevent the noodles from sticking together.
  • Crispy Bacon Hack: For the crispiest bacon with minimal mess, bake it in the oven! Lay bacon strips on a foil-lined baking sheet and bake at 400°F (200°C) for 15-20 minutes, or until desired crispiness is achieved. This method ensures even cooking and easy cleanup. Alternatively, using pre-cooked bacon is a fantastic time-saver.
  • Shred vs. Cube Chicken: The texture of your chicken can significantly impact the salad. If you prefer a softer texture that melds more seamlessly with the dressing, shred the chicken. This allows the creamy dressing to coat the chicken fibers more evenly. You can shred chicken quickly and efficiently by placing cooked chicken breasts in your stand mixer with the paddle attachment and running it on low for 30-60 seconds. For a more substantial bite, cube the chicken into small pieces.
  • Chill Before Serving for Flavor Development: While you can eat this salad right away, allowing it to ch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es (or even a few hours) before serving truly allows the flavors to meld and deepen. The pasta will absorb some of the dressing, intensifying every bite.
  • Toss with Half the Dressing First: To avoid an overdressed or soggy salad, start by mixing in only half of the prepared dressing. Toss well, then gradually add more as needed until the salad reaches your desired level of creaminess. Remember, the pasta will continue to absorb dressing as it sits.
  • Prevent Watery Salad When Making Ahead: If you’re preparing this salad a day or more in advance, store the chopped vegetables, cooked chicken, and dressing in separate airtight containers. Cook the pasta and add it to the dressing and other ingredients closer to serving time to prevent the vegetables from releasing excess water and making the salad watery.
  • Use Rotisserie Chicken for Convenience: Short on time? A store-bought rotisserie chicken is your best friend! Simply shred or dice the cooked chicken, and you’ve instantly cut down on prep time without sacrificing flavor.
  • Customize the Texture: Don’t be afraid to experiment with textures. For an extra satisfying crunch, consider adding toasted sunflower seeds, slivered almonds, croutons, or even crispy fried onions just before serving.

🌡️ Storage and Make-Ahead Tips

Proper storage is key to enjoying your Creamy Bacon Ranch Chicken Pasta Salad for days. This salad is excellent for meal prep and gatherings, but a few considerations will ensure it stays fresh and delicious.

Storage: Store any leftover pasta salad in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2-3 days. The flavors tend to deepen overnight, making it even tastier the next day. However, as it sits, the pasta will continue to absorb the dressing, which might make it slightly less creamy over time. If needed, you can stir in a tablespoon or two of milk or a little extra mayonnaise and Italian dressing before serving to refresh the consistency.

Make-Ahead Strategy: This creamy pasta salad is a fantastic make-ahead option, especially for potlucks or busy weeknights. To maintain the freshest texture and prevent the salad from becoming watery or soggy, it’s best to keep certain components separate until just before serving:

  • Cook and cool the pasta, then store it separately in an airtight container.
  • Cook and prepare the chicken and bacon, storing them in their own separate airtight containers.
  • Chop all your fresh vegetables and keep them in a separate container.
  • Prepare the dressing and store it in a jar or container in the refrigerator.

Combine all these components about an hour or two before you plan to serve. This method ensures the vegetables remain crisp, the pasta doesn’t get overly soft, and the dressing retains its perfect consistency.

Freezing is Not Recommended: Unfortunately, this creamy pasta salad does not stand up well to freezing. The mayonnaise-based dressing can separate and become oily or watery when thawed, and the fresh vegetables will likely lose their crispness and become mushy. It’s best enjoyed fresh and within a few days of preparation.

❔ Recipe FAQ’s

Can I make this pasta salad ahead of time?

Absolutely! This pasta salad is fantastic for making ahead as the flavors develop beautifully over time. For the best texture, we recommend storing the cooked pasta, the prepared dressing, and the other chopped ingredients (chicken, bacon, vegetables) in separate airtight containers in the refrigerator. Combine everything together about 1-2 hours before you plan to serve to ensure the vegetables stay crisp and the pasta doesn’t get overly soft. Stir well before serving.

Can I use a store-bought ranch dressing instead of the dry mix?

Yes, you certainly can for added convenience! If you opt for a store-bought creamy ranch dressing, you will need approximately 1 ¼ to 1 ½ cups, depending on your preferred level of creaminess. When using store-bought ranch, you can skip the mayonnaise entirely and reduce the milk to about ¼ cup (or omit it if the dressing is already very creamy). However, you’ll still want to add the red wine vinegar, white vinegar, olive oil, and Italian dressing to achieve the unique tangy and complex flavor profile of this specific recipe.

What can I add to customize this salad?

This salad is wonderfully customizable! You can add a variety of ingredients to enhance its flavor and texture. Consider adding black olives (sliced), shredded cheddar or Monterey Jack cheese, diced avocado, or extra fresh veggies like shredded carrots, corn kernels, or diced celery for more crunch. Fresh herbs such as chopped chives or dill also make a fantastic addition. For an extra pop of flavor, a squeeze of lemon juice before serving can brighten everything up.

What type of pasta works best?

We prefer vermicelli noodles because they are thin and absorb the dressing well without becoming mushy. However, many other pasta shapes work beautifully! Good alternatives include angel hair pasta, rotini, penne, bow tie (farfalle) pasta, or even elbow macaroni. The key is to choose a shape that can hold the dressing and other ingredients effectively.

Can I make it vegetarian?

Absolutely! To make this pasta salad vegetarian, simply omit the bacon and chicken. You can replace the chicken with a plant-based protein like seasoned grilled tofu, tempeh, or chickpeas. For the bacon, consider using a vegetarian bacon substitute or simply enjoy the salad without it.

Equipment

  • whisk
  • large skillet
  • bowls
  • instant read thermometer

Ingredients

  • 8-10 slices bacon (cooked and crumbled)
  • 3-4 chicken breasts (boneless, skinless, cooked and diced/shredded)
  • 16 oz Vermicelli noodles (or other thin pasta, cooked al dente and rinsed)
  • 2 large tomatoes (diced)
  • 1 cucumber *Long English cucumber, diced
  • 1 green bell pepper (diced)
  • 1 yellow bell pepper (diced)
  • ½ red onion (finely diced)

Salad Dressing

  • 1.5 ounces dry Ranch dressing mix (about 1 ½ packages) * I use Hidden Valley
  • ½ cup milk * I use 1 % milk (or milk of choice)
  • ¾ cup mayonnaise * I use Hellman’s ½ the fat (or your favorite brand)
  • 3 tablespoon red wine vinegar
  • 3 tablespoon white vinegar
  • 3 tablespoon olive oil
  • 3 tablespoon water
  • 3 teaspoon Italian dressing
US Customary – Metric

Instructions

  • Cook chicken until thoroughly done, then dice or shred it. Cook bacon until crispy and crumble. Set both aside to cool. (See Expert Tips for crispy bacon hack).
  • Cook pasta as per package directions until al dente. Drain thoroughly and rinse with cold water to cool and prevent sticking.
  • In a small bowl, whisk all salad dressing ingredients together until well combined and smooth.
  • In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ooled pasta, cooked chicken, crumbled bacon, all the chopped vegetables (tomatoes, cucumber, green and yellow bell peppers, red onion). Pour the prepared ranch dressing over the ingredients. *You can cut some chicken into larger chunks for garnish, or simply dice all the chicken into small bite-sized pieces and mix well.
  • Toss everything gently until all ingredients are evenly coated with the creamy dressing. For best flavor, ch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before serving. Garnish with Parmesan cheese, fresh parsley, or extra bacon bits, if desired.

Nutrition

Serving: 1.5cups | Calories: 492kcal (25%) | Carbohydrates: 58g (19%) | Protein: 15g (30%) | Fat: 21g (32%) | Saturated Fat: 5g (31%) | Polyunsaturated Fat: 5g | Monounsaturated Fat: 9g | Trans Fat: 0.05g | Cholesterol: 46mg (15%) | Sodium: 896mg (39%) | Potassium: 477mg (14%) | Fiber: 2g (8%) | Sugar: 4g (4%) | Vitamin A: 556IU (11%) | Vitamin C: 48mg (58%) | Calcium: 49mg (5%) | Iron: 1mg (6%)
